Choosing the Right PHP Framework: 6 Key Considerations

You've decided a framework is essential for your next application. While familiarity with a specific framework is tempting, thorough consideration is crucial to ensure a long-term, efficient solution. Before committing, ask yourself these six key questions:

1. Essential Framework Functionality:

Prioritize needed functionality over familiarity. A full-stack framework is overkill if you only require routing. Clearly define your application's requirements before comparing frameworks to narrow your options effectively.

2. Maintaining Code Consistency:

Large development teams, especially distributed ones, face challenges in maintaining consistent coding styles. Frameworks can assist, but they aren't a replacement for robust coding standards, code reviews, and internal policies.

3. Documentation and Support:

High-quality documentation and readily available training resources are invaluable. Remember, you'll be working with someone else's code. Choose a framework with a proven track record of comprehensive documentation to maximize efficiency and understanding.

4. Active Development and Community:

Frameworks often become integral to applications. A dormant or declining framework leaves you with the daunting task of self-maintenance or a complete rewrite. Thoroughly investigate the framework's development history and community engagement to avoid future headaches.

5. Production Environment Compatibility:

Ensure framework compatibility with your production environment. While PHP offers a relatively stable environment compared to JavaScript, operating system upgrades and PHP version changes can impact compatibility. Verify the framework doesn't rely on deprecated features to prevent log file errors.

6. Business Factors:

Business considerations can heavily influence framework selection. For example, aligning with a client's preferred framework might be necessary, even if it's not the ideal technical choice. Weigh the potential benefits and drawbacks of such decisions carefully.

Not all applications require a framework. However, if you've determined one is necessary, a careful comparison of your needs against available frameworks is essential to ensure the best fit. This might be a familiar framework or a new one, but objective analysis guarantees the optimal choice.
